RAPPER G-DEP CONFESSES TO MURDER

G-Dep in da building for Mellove music video

A rapper named, Trevell Coleman who was signed to Diddy’s label confessed to a murder on Wednesday night that happened 17 years ago. He is better known as G Dep. Coleman walked into a police station and explained when he was only 18 years old that he had shot and killed someone 17 years ago. The shooting happened at an East Harlem housing project. A police sourced added that Trevell Coleman said that “It was eating away at him.” The way it happened Coleman explains he announced a robbery and the victim John Henkel who was 32 at the time, resisted and grabbed his .40-caliber gun. Coleman then confesses that he pulled away and shot Henkel in the chest three times, fled, and threw the weapon into the East River. The victim was rushed to the hospital where he later died. When the detective reviewed the cold case he was amazed at how much the stories matched up.
